Too Much Of A Good Thing
J.J. Murray

From the acclaimed author of Something Real and Original Love comes a tender, witty, and sexy tale of two very different souls whose prayers are answered in surprising ways?

Kensington
February 2009
On Sale: February 1, 2009
Featuring: Joe Murphy; Shawna Mitchell
352 pages
ISBN: 0758228864
EAN: 9780758228864
Paperback
Add to Wish List

Contemporary | Multicultural

When recently widowed Joe Murphy “meets” Shawna Mitchell in an online forum, all he’s seeking is advice on keeping his home and his family together. Shawna’s compassionate e-mails become his lifeline, and as months pass their correspondence grows deep and warm. Discovering that Shawna lives only blocks away…well, it feels like more than luck. It feels a lot like hope.

With three children to raise, Shawna has no interest in getting close to another man, let alone one who’s got three kids of his own. And the fact that Joe’s white can only complicate matters more. But now, as they navigate family dates and vacations and their own doubts and fears, Joe and Shawna find themselves moving toward a future that’s bright, new, and totally unexpected. Because the only thing more difficult than uniting two stubborn families would be walking away from something that feels so right…
